2016–17 Sunshine Tour
The 2016–17 Sunshine Tour was the 17th season of professional golf tournaments since the southern Africa based Sunshine Tour was relaunched in 2000. The season marked a return to a multi-year schedule, the first since the 2006–07 season and ended in March 2017. The Sunshine Tour represents the highest level of competition for male professional golfers in the region.
